- Title
Statistical methodologies in psychopharmacology: a review.
- Authors
Nieminen, Pentti; Miettunen, Jouko; Koponen, Hannu; Isohanni, Matti
- Abstract
There has been a greatly increased interest in statistical methods in the psychiatric research and its applications over the past few decades, in parallel with advances in computers and statistical software. This review aims to describe the main topics related to statistical methods in psychopharmacology, namely nature of statistics in medicine, problems in data analysis, statistical modelling, developments in statistical technology, statistical reporting and meta-analysis.
